Application Process for the German Driving License
The application procedure for acquiring a German driving license may seem daunting, however it can be broken down into manageable actions:
Step-by-Step Guide:
Determine License Class: Assess which class of driving license you need based on your driving requirements.
Gather Required Documents: Typical files required include:
- A legitimate form of recognition (passport or ID card)
- Proof of residency (Meldebescheinigung)
- A recent biometric image
- Medical certificate (for particular classes)
- Vision test certificate
Enlist in a Driving School: It's necessary in Germany to undergo training at a qualified driving school. Many driving schools provide assistance on the application procedure.
Complete Theory Lessons: Applicants should finish a series of theory lessons and pass a written test.
Practical Lessons: After successfully completing the theoretical part, candidates can start practical driving lessons.
Pass the Practical Driving Test: Once the instructor deems the applicant prepared, they must pass a useful driving exam.
Send Application: After passing both tests, send the application in addition to the necessary paperwork and fees at the regional driver's licensing authority (Fahrerlaubnisbehörde).
Receive the Driving License: Once processed, the driving license will be issued.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How long does it take to get a driving license in Germany?
The timeframe depends upon the individual's preparation and accessibility of visits for tests. Normally, it takes several weeks to a few months.
2. Can I use my foreign driving license in Germany?
Yes, non-EU driving licenses stand for 6 months. After this duration, you might need to transform it to a German driving license.
3. What is the minimum age to get a driving license in Germany?
The minimum age differs by license class, but typically, candidates should be at least 18 years old for Class B licenses.
4. Are there any health requirements for acquiring a driving license?
Yes, particular medical evaluations may be needed, especially for higher classes like C and D.
5. What should I do if I stop working the driving test?
You can retake the test after a waiting duration. It is advisable to take extra lessons before trying once again.
